WuzaWuza is a professional music and dance company with three divisions:
. Research and Documentation
. Music and Dance
. Cultural Exchange Programmes
Besides developing and producing dance pieces, the company has a repertory of traditional African music and dance, contemporary music and dance and the new African Afrikiki dance form. The company has two branches, one in the north and one in the southern part of Ghana. Wuza-Wuza is patronized by Professor Emeritus Kwabena Nketia (1921). The professor is a world renowned musicologist and composer who founded and directs the International Centre for African Music and Dance (ICAMD) of the University of Ghana in Legon, a suburb of Accra.
The name WuzaWuza
WuzaWuza stands for ‘You and us together as one'. The name is a combination of the word ‘Wu' (Akan dialect for ‘you') and the word ‘Zaa' (Dagbani dialect for ‘together as one'). Of course it also represents the founders first name (...)
